Blennd is an award-winning digital agency based in Denver, specializing in web design, development, and digital marketing. They partner with businesses from startups to Fortune 500 to deliver tailored strategies, custom designs, and impactful marketing solutions that drive conversions.

Multi-location SEO experts specializing in scaling search engine optimization for franchises and businesses with 10 or more locations. Led by adjunct professor and Industry MVP Steve Wiideman, the agency offers strategic audits, consulting retainers, and training services to agencies and in-house teams. Clients include SKECHERS, Public Storage, Meineke Car Care, Applebee's, and IHOP.
